Sanath Jayasuriya has denied Indian media reports which accused him of smuggling rotten betel nuts to India.
The former cricketer took to his Twitter handle to say “I have never been involved in any business activity dealing with betel nuts”
This is absolutely false and I have never been involved in any business activity dealing with Betel Nut. I completely deny the contents of the article and my lawyers have already responded to this defamatory and false article. - Sanath Jayasuriya
